Chicago Burlington & Quincy Railroad E9 9995 eastbound at Naperville, Illinois on April 19, 1965, Ektachrome by Chuck Zeiler. Built in August 1954 (c/n 19634) on EMD Order 2065A for six E9's (#'s 9990-9995), this was the highest numbered E9, and for that matter, the highest numbered locomotive on the CB&Q diesel roster. It was not the last E9 delivered, the following year the CB&Q ordered 10 more E9's (#'s 9985A-B through 9989A-B), the CB&Q's final passenger locomotive acquisition. This one went on to become BN 9995 and after rebuilding by Morrison-Knudsen became BN 9925, retired from Chicago commuter service in 1992. Seen here in charge of one of the daily CB&Q Dinkys (commuter train), it has in tow five of the single level coaches, a pair of Budd bi-level stainless steel coaches, and a power car converted from one of the single level coaches. Within a few years, all the single level coaches would be retired, the power cars would survive a few more years to power solid trains of bi-level Budd coaches until 26 E8's and E9's were rebuilt by M-K with Head End Power.
